What it does not do — a boundary, not a footnote

It does not accept documents.

A scan sent into the chat goes nowhere. The application is registered by the admissions office — the agent will say what is needed, where to bring it and by what hour, but it accepts nothing itself.

It does not admit anyone and does not work out the competition.

The ranking lists and the orders are yours. It will explain how the competition works under your rules, but it will not name a place in the list and will not judge anyone's chances.

He doesn’t know anything about the applicant.

Unified State Exam scores, application status and place on the competitive list live in the admissions committee system, and he does not have access to it. He will tell you where they are watching it and when the dean’s office is open. Moodle and EIOS — are already about those enrolled: he reads them, and only if you have connected them.

This is a screen of its own, not a footnote at the bottom: if an applicant decides they have submitted their documents through a chat, they will learn the truth on 26 July and lose a year.

Questions

What is the file it sends?

A table — CSV or XLSX: a line per document, original or copy, by what date, where to take it. It is put together from your rules for the programme that was asked about and goes out as an attachment straight into the conversation. An applicant does not have to copy the checklist out of a chat by hand.

Does it really go to the site?

Yes, and it needs none of your keys for that: search and reading a page by a link come in the package. It will open the admissions section on the university's site, read it and retell it — with the link, so that it can be checked. It does not watch the site: it looks when it is asked to.

Does it answer where applicants write?

Yes: Telegram, WhatsApp, VK, MAX and email. The university's VKontakte page and the admissions office's mailbox are the two main points of July, and both come together in one window along with the messengers.

Where does it get the admission rules?

You give it your documents once: the admission rules, the deadlines, the checklist, the minimum scores, previous years' cut-off scores, the terms for sponsored places, the rules for moving into halls. It answers only from them. What is not there it does not invent: it says outright that it has no such answer.

The rules change in the middle of the campaign. What then?

You edit them in one place — and it answers from the new version, and builds the file from the new version too. That is the whole point of a single source: today twelve people read a new version twelve different ways, and the discrepancy surfaces as a complaint in August.

Does it accept documents and admit students?

No, and we will not promise that. Submission, registering the application, the ranking lists and the admission orders stay with the admissions office. It will explain what is needed, where to bring it, by what hour and what happens if a document is missing — but it accepts nothing itself.

And what if they ask about themselves — my scores, my place in the list?

The applicant does not have — and he will not pretend to see it: Unified State Examination scores, application status and place on the competitive list live in the admissions committee system, he does not have access to it. He will tell you where they are watching it and what hours the dean’s office is open. The price of the fictitious answer here is — lost year. For an enrolled student, the picture is different: he reads the connected Moodle and EIOS and from them he will tell what was not passed and what is the next deadline.

We have three institutes with different rules. Will it mix them up?

The materials are given per programme, and the answer is about the programme that was named. If the person did not name one, the agent asks rather than guesses: “state-funded” means different numbers in different institutes.

Does it answer about halls of residence and the exam period too?

Yes, if you have given it those materials: the rules for moving in, what to bring, the deadlines, the exam timetable and the dean's office hours. The admissions campaign ends in August, the questions do not, and for the second half of the year the agent works for students.

Where are the conversations with applicants stored?

On your own server. This plan installs inside your perimeter, so the correspondence, the phone numbers and the names of applicants and students never leave it and never travel to someone else's cloud.
